Defensive end Micah Parsons’ return to AT&T Stadium in Dallas was one of the biggest stories this week. The four-time Pro Bowler, traded from the Cowboys to the Green Bay Packers in August, has also been making headlines off the field, this time, for his growing love of pickleball.Revealing that it was his agent, David Mulugheta, who first introduced him to the sport, Parsons said, “David had a pickleball event like two years ago in Austin. We all came down, and that sparked my interest.” “As it started growing, I ended up getting a stake in the Ranchers, and that’s when I really started getting involved, wanting to be around it, learning more about it,” Parsons told CBS Sports analyst Bryant McFadden.He now plays regularly and has even incorporated it into his offseason workouts.“I’m playing like two, three times a week,” confirmed Parsons.“It’s like great cardio playing singles. I’m addicted.”Despite his enthusiasm, Parsons knows there’s more to learn.“I think I’m an okay player. I’ve played against some pros and some outstanding players, so I’m like, okay. There are levels to it,” he said.“Pickleball is all about touch. It ain’t really about how strong you can hit it. It’s about touch, feel, and placement. It’s strategic. I’m still mastering it. It’s hard.”The Packers star also has teammates who share his passion. Tight ends Tucker Kraft and Luke Musgrave are frequent visitors to The Picklr in Green Bay.“It’s just an easy sport to play for a long time,” said Kraft.“As long as you’re having fun, it doesn’t really matter how competitive the games get or who you’re playing with.”
